How To Make It

Now, let’s dive into how to make this Zucchini & Corn Casserole. It’s as easy as combining your ingredients and letting the oven work its magic. You’ll love how straightforward this is – perfect for those busy weeknights or last-minute gatherings.

Preparation

First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F. While that’s heating up, take your zucchini and grate it. You want to squeeze out any excess moisture, so it doesn’t make your casserole soggy.

Then, in your baking dish, combine the grated zucchini, sweet corn, and bacon grease, stirring it all up until everything is evenly coated.

In a separate mixing bowl, whisk together your eggs, milk, and all-purpose seasoning. This is where the magic happens; you want it well combined. Once that’s ready, pour it over the zucchini and corn mixture.

Finally, add in your shredded cheese and gently stir to make sure everything is evenly distributed.

Cooking

Now it’s time to bake! Pop your casserole in the oven and let it do its thing for about 35 to 45 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when the center is set and no longer jiggles.

Keep an eye on it – you want it to turn a beautiful golden brown on top. The smell wafting through your kitchen will be absolutely irresistible, trust me on this one.

Once it’s out of the oven, let it cool for about 10 minutes before serving. This cooling time helps it set up a bit more and makes it easier to slice. You’ll want to see a nice firm texture on the edges, with a creamy center.

Zucchini & Corn Casserole

Print Pin Rate
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 45 minutes
Total Time: 1 hour
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 2 zucchini grated
  • 1 cup whole kernel sweet corn
  • 1 cup shredded cheese
  • 1 cup milk
  • 6 eggs
  • 2 tablespoons bacon grease
  • 1 tablespoon all-purpose seasoning salt, pepper, garlic

Instructions

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F.
  • In an 8×8-inch baking dish, combine the grated zucchini, sweet corn, and bacon grease. Stir until everything is evenly coated.
  • In a m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, and all-purpose seasoning until well combined. Pour the egg mixture over the zucchini and corn mixture. Add the shredded cheese and gently stir to distribute the ingredients evenly.
  • Bake for 35 to 45 minutes, or until the center is set and no longer jiggles. Remove from the oven and let the casserole cool for 10 minutes before serving.
